Questions and Answers

Can my older ductwork handle better air filters for Penndel's pollen and ozone issues?

Galvanized steel ductwork from 1950s homes often struggles with MERV-13 filters due to increased static pressure. Penndel's May pollen peak and ozone risk create legitimate indoor air quality concerns, but forcing high-MERV filters through restrictive ductwork reduces airflow and system efficiency. A better approach involves installing a dedicated air cleaner or upgrading duct sections near the air handler. Proper static pressure testing determines what filtration level your specific system can accommodate without compromising performance.

What does an Ecobee E1 error code mean for my Penndel HVAC system?

An Ecobee E1 alert indicates the thermostat has lost communication with your HVAC equipment. In Penndel's humid climate, this often results from condensate overflow triggering a safety float switch that cuts power to the system. The error prevents equipment operation regardless of thermostat settings. Checking the condensate drain line and drain pan should be your first troubleshooting step. Persistent E1 codes may indicate wiring issues or control board failures that require professional diagnosis.

Should I consider switching from natural gas to a heat pump in Penndel?

Modern cold-climate heat pumps work effectively in Penndel's winter conditions, with most maintaining full capacity down to 5°F. The economic case depends on your natural gas versus electricity rates and the $8,000 IRA rebate for qualified installations. Programming the heat pump to avoid PECO's 14:00-19:00 peak rate hours maximizes savings. For homes with existing natural gas infrastructure, a dual-fuel system that uses gas during extreme cold provides the most cost-effective heating solution.

What permits and safety standards apply to new HVAC installations in Penndel?

All HVAC installations in Penndel require permits from the Penndel Borough Building and Zoning Department. The 2026 standards mandate specific safety protocols for R-454B and other A2L refrigerants, including leak detection systems and proper ventilation in equipment rooms. These mildly flammable refrigerants require different handling procedures than previous generations. Licensed contractors must complete EPA Section 608 certification for A2L refrigerants and follow manufacturer-specific installation guidelines to maintain warranty coverage and ensure safe operation.

How do the new SEER2 standards affect my utility bills in Penndel?

The 2026 minimum SEER2 requirement of 14.3 represents about 15% more efficiency than previous standards. At Penndel's current 0.16/kWh electricity rate, upgrading from a 10 SEER system to a 16 SEER2 unit saves approximately $300 annually on cooling costs. The Inflation Reduction Act provides up to $8,000 in rebates for qualifying high-efficiency installations. Combined with PECO's Smart Home Rebates, these incentives make system upgrades economically practical for many homeowners.
